How they compare
Mongolia currently reports 35.53 % against 6.42 % in Western Europe, a difference of 29.11 %.
That makes Mongolia's figure about 5.5 times Western Europe's.
Across all 34 years both countries report, Mongolia has been ahead every year.
Mongolia ranks 10th and Western Europe ranks 12th of 209 countries.
Mongolia has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Mongolia | Western Europe |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 70.36 % | 4.67 % | 65.69 % | Mongolia |
| 2000s | 68.2 % | 4.88 % | 63.32 % | Mongolia |
| 2010s | 42.19 % | 5.49 % | 36.7 % | Mongolia |
| 2020s | 36.8 % | 6.17 % | 30.62 % | Mongolia |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ions indicators disseminates indicators on sectoral shares of total national greenhouse gas (GHG) emissions as well as three indicators of emissions intensity: per capita emissions; emissions per value of agricultural production; and emissions per area of agricultural land.
